Chill the dough before baking to create thick bakery-style cookies.
Reserve some mix-ins for pressing onto the tops before baking to create a professional bakery appearance.
Slightly underbake the cookies—they'll continue cooking on the hot baking sheet.
Use good-quality chocolate chips for the richest flavor.
Do not overmix the dough after adding the flour to keep the cookies soft.
Store in an airtight container at room temperature for 4–5 days.
Freeze baked cookies for up to 3 months.
Freeze unbaked cookie dough balls for up to 2 months. Bake directly from frozen, adding 2–3 extra minutes to the baking time.
For extra gooey cookies, add a few extra chocolate chips immediately after removing them from the oven.
